china is spending billions of dollars in secret development spending, twice as much as the us and other major powers combined. american researchers from aid data found that most of the lending is in the form of risky high interest loans from chinese state banks. the figures are startling, there s been 13,500 infrastructure projects over the last 18 years. combined, the projects are worth more than $843 billion. and the lending is spread far and wide, with projects in 165 countries. and just look at the difference in international loans compared to the us over the last 20 years. while washington s loans have stayed relatively steady, beijing s investment has boomed. it s been quite a change for china, which only recently was a recipient of foreign aid, receiving more than $1 billion in 2003 from the us.
